The beliefs that drive people( For those who are interested in “Why')

April 24,2012 was celebrated as Akshaya Thrithiyai a festival recently rediscovered to buy gold. It all started five years ago when a smart jeweler in our town caught hold of a so called Prohit to sow a belief that will boost his sales. A Prohit is a person who projects himself to have great knowledge of Hindu rituals and dresses him self in distinctly peculiar ways, fore head shaved and the hair left to grow long on the back is tied in a knot. They wear some religious marks on the temple either three horizontal bands of holy ash or a white U or Y mark having a red line in the middle. Just as one does not question an automobile mechanic, people in India do not question these Prohits also. It is understood that there are some Veda Schools that teach the authentic techniques for the popular rituals and the Vedic rhymes that are to be chanted as mantras during the rituals.
